11 65 035 Removing And Installing/Replacing Charger (BMW ALPINA B7 Radial Compressor)

Disconnect plug connection (1).

Unlock and detach quick-connect couplings (2).

Unclip cable from holder (3).

Release hose clamps (4) and remove charge air hose.

Installation: 

Tightening torque: 5 Nm.

Charge air hose must be installed dry and free from grease!

Unscrew screws (1) and (2).

IMPORTANT: Bear in mind different bolt length (risk of damage):
  • Bolt (1), front: 8x30 
  • Bolt (2), rear: 8x35 

Installation: 

Tightening torque: 21 Nm.

Unclip vacuum line from holder (1).

Remove screws (2) and (3).

IMPORTANT: Bear in mind different bolt length (risk of damage):
  • Bolt (2), front: 8x30 
  • Bolt (3), rear: 8x35 

Carefully lift out radial compressor (4).

Installation: 

Replace both lower sealing rings on radial compressor.

Tightening torque: 21 Nm.

IMPORTANT: When reinstalling the radial compressor, make sure that both adapter sleeves (1) are in place.

Modify following components when replacing the radial compressor. 

Release screws (1) and modify belt pulley (2) to new radial compressor.

Installation: 

Tighten screws crosswise.

Tightening torque: 9 Nm.

IMPORTANT: Make sure that spacer is fitted between radial compressor and belt pulley.

Release bolts (1) and modify manifold with charge-air pressure actuator to new radial compressor.

Installation: 

Tightening torque: 9 Nm.

IMPORTANT: Follow instructions in the next work step.

Make sure that spacer sleeve (1) is modified in new radial compressor.

Seal (2) must always be replaced.

Release screws (1) and modify manifold (2) to new radial compressor.

Installation: 

Replace seal.

Tightening torque: 9 Nm.
